Output 008e886879c07ee4981e58af3a8d9f481201b1d6d65b032a00a76da94ddb6dd2:0

value
3684010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ebf988af533e160b8dd707e2b9ae976b3c53cb8 OP_EQUAL
address
3EhoQ6eLtqgkCCHmFSiYS7Pkej8kfsXtwG
transaction
008e886879c07ee4981e58af3a8d9f481201b1d6d65b032a00a76da94ddb6dd2
confirmations
267832
spent
true